1879UMKY - Unidentified Male
Photo of decedent, partial upper dental plate (flipper)
Date of Discovery: December 3, 2009
Location of Discovery: Louisville, Jefferson County, Kentucky
Estimated Date of Death: Same as date of discovery
State of Remains: Recognizable face
Cause of Death: Homicide by gunshot
Physical Description
Estimated Age: 30-40 years oldRace: White and/or Hispanic
Sex: Male
Height: 5'4", measured
Weight: 131 lbs., measured
Hair Color: Black, 2" long, wavy
Eye Color: Brown
Distinguishing Marks/Features: Bilateral lumbar scar on back. Multiple linear scars in various orientations, all 1/4" to 2 1/2" in length.
Identifiers
Dentals: Available. Extensive dental work. Complete loss of crown #29. Small occlusal pit caries on #17. Teeth #7-#10 replaced with "flipper" with non-cast clasp.Fingerprints: Available with Louisville Metro Police. Rt: WM LS 10 16 13; Lt: 19 13 13 12 11.
DNA: Sample available. Status of submission unknown.
Clothing & Personal Items
Clothing: Izod jacket (long-sleeved, gray); Izod polo shirt (short-sleeved, orange with white stripes); Ice Pole jeans (blue); bikini briefs (blue); socks (red/black); and Air Jordan athletic shoes (black).The decedent's clothing is in custody of the Louisville Metro Police Department.
Jewelry: Unknown
Additional Personal Items: Unknown
Circumstances of Discovery
Louisville Metro Police and EMS responded to a report of shots fired shortly after midnight at the Preston Oaks apartment complex in the 1200 block of Quest Drive, where they found a man who had been shot down in his apartment during a robbery. He was taken to University Hospital where he was pronounced dead from multiple gunshot wounds at 12:52 a.m.A photo of the victim was found on a cell phone. Police believe the man is from either Mexico or Honduras. He was given the nickname "Juan Doe" by people who paid for his burial.
Five people are serving time for his murder and other related crimes. The robbery was random and the suspects do not know the victim.
